Urine Drug Testing Services

Urine drug testing is a non-invasive method used to detect drug metabolites in a person's system, typically within a few days of usage. It involves collecting a urine sample which is then analyzed in a laboratory for different substances. It is one of the most common forms of drug testing.

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breathalyzer
  • Blood test
  • Saliva test
  • Urine test
  • Sweat patch

Breathalyzer - Provides quick results for immediate analysis

Blood test - Offers high accuracy and is used in legal contexts

Saliva test - Convenient with a moderate detection window

Urine test - Detects presence after ingestion for several days

Sweat patch - Monitors continuous alcohol consumption

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ing in South Yarmouth, Massachusetts offers an innovative way to detect drug exposure over the long term by analyzing the keratin in nails.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Detects drug use from past 4-6 months
  • Toenails: Offers extended detection up to 12 months
